Persian Ivy, scientifically known as Hedera colchica, is a robust, evergreen climbing vine native to the Caucasus and Middle East. Renowned for its large, glossy leaves, this plant is valued in traditional medicine for its potential therapeutic properties, often utilized for its bioactive compounds in treating various ailments.

Taxonomical Classification

This plant belongs to the kingdom Plantae and is classified under the phylum Streptophyta within the class Equisetopsida. It falls under the subclass Magnoliidae and the order Apiales, specifically being a member of the family Araliaceae. Finally, it is categorized under the genus Hedera.

Botanical Identification

Ecology

The ecology of Hedera colchica is characterized by its preference for shaded and semi-shaded environments, typically thriving within forest ecosystems and across stony places. This species demonstrates a significant altitudinal adaptability, occupying a wide vertical range that extends up to an elevation of 1200 m AMSL. By colonizing both the nutrient-rich floor of woodlands and the more rugged, rocky terrains, it plays a role in stabilizing soil and providing microhabitats within these diverse landscape structures.

Life history

The life history of Hedera colchica is characterized by its status as a perennial plant, allowing it to persist through multiple growing seasons and establish a stable presence within its habitat. In terms of its structural life form, it is classified as a phanerophyte, specifically functioning as a phanerophyte (and categorized within the nanophanerophyte range depending on its growth stage and environmental context), which indicates that its perennating buds are located on aerial shoots well above the ground. This growth strategy enables the plant to climb and spread effectively, utilizing its woody structure to navigate its ecological niche over an extended lifespan.

Reproduction

The reproduction of Hedera colchica involves both sexual and asexual mechanisms. The plant is capable of asexual reproduction, which is present in its biological profile. For sexual reproduction, the flowering period is quite extensive, typically beginning in September and concluding in October, though the specific timing can be variable across different conditions. The resulting seeds are notably consistent in size, with a recorded seed mass that maintains a mean, minimum, and maximum value of 0.05401 g.
